Output ce74ba14efcafd528f32e9c8a83c2ec309401f296b2f707b1699b04607222b92:0

value
10679106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9aa5f0667004ed00afe4d737da50dd25403dfd OP_EQUAL
address
3HWx5sk5LodpJNAVpwxRF7uMnVHePbY6qD
transaction
ce74ba14efcafd528f32e9c8a83c2ec309401f296b2f707b1699b04607222b92
confirmations
474136
spent
true